Easter Salad is a vibrant and refreshing dish that brings a burst of color and flavor to your spring gatherings. This delightful salad features the sweetness of fresh strawberries, creamy goat cheese, and crunchy toasted almonds, all tossed in a tangy Lemon Honey Vinaigrette. Ingredients
- 1 cup slivered almonds
- 12 ounces mixed spring greens
- 16 ounces strawberries (washed, hulled, & sliced)
- 4 ounces crumbled goat cheese
- 1/2 cup olive oil
- 5 tablespoons lemon juice
- 2 tablespoons honey
- sea salt
- black pepper
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 350°F. Spread slivered almonds on a sheet pan and toast for 5-7 minutes until golden brown. Allow to cool.
- In a Mason jar, combine olive oil, lemon juice, honey, salt, and pepper. Shake well to mix.
- In a large mixing bowl, layer mixed greens, sliced strawberries, toasted almonds, and crumbled goat cheese. Drizzle with vinaigrette just before serving and toss gently.
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 7 minutes
